What It Takes To Guarantee Your Kids’ Security Online
The internet has a lot to offer people of all ages, but it poses certain dangers to children. As valuable a resource as the computer is; it also has some very negative sides when it comes to villains who take advantage of the accessibility to kids, this is where you the parents come in. This matter is troublesome to a most folks; the good news is that there are measures you can take to insure their safety. Now we will investigate some of the safety measures that can be applied when your kids are internet surfing.
Talk to your children about internet safety. When you are quizzing your kids about what they’ve been up to online, or when you’ve placed specific limits on them, let them know that you’re just doing it because you’re concerned and want to look after them. Even though your children won’t necessarily appreciate you doing this, if they come across a problem they might be more inclined to talk to you about it. Make sure you fully educate them regarding the potential dangers of the internet, as well as educating them about people not always being who they say they are. If you talk openly with your kids regarding any concerns you have, and if you listen to them when they may feel uncomfortable, they’ll be a lot safer.
It is important to keep communication lines open with you child so they can talk to you, even though things do not normally reach this extreme. You can notify the school, the parents of the child or the site the bully is using if you find out your child is being bullied. Make sure your children know enough to never meet someone they don’t know offline in any public place. Even though this might appear to be a very obvious thing for you, it might not be for young children who have just started using the internet. Additionally they shouldn’t talk privately with any strangers, regardless of whether it’s in a private online chat room or over the telephone. Public chatrooms are where predators will initially target children, then they will try and move them over to a setting that’s more private, which could be online or offline. Make sure your kids let you know if anybody does this, especially if they instruct the kids to not mention this to their parents. Children who are younger need to be told these sorts of things.
Predators who seek out children online may do so in many different environments, but the most likely place they’ll be lurking is chatrooms. You will almost certainly have a predator contact you, if you are a child going into a chatroom, as reported by the FBI. Unfortunately, this sad fact of modern life is true. Younger children do not belong in chatrooms, because they are not old enough to know who to trust, especially without supervision. The internet, especially chatrooms, is not a very trusting place, and children need to learn not to believe what anyone tells them, and watch what they reveal online. Another area to watch carefully is AOL Instant Messenger, because, next to chatrooms, this is where predators are looking for children.
If you want to protect your child better then make sure you are familiar with all their online activities. If your child tries to stop you from getting involved online with them, then you need to make it clear to them that you want to know what they are doing and who they are talking to when they are online. You do not need to live in fear about this but it is sensible for you to take basic precautions.
